Postville School District to hold Special Election on March 4

The Postville School District will be holding a Special Election on Tuesday, March 4, to fill a school board vacancy and specify the use of Postville School revenue.

There will be two different polling places depending on where voters live within the school district. 

The voting place for voters who live in the Postville Community School District and reside in Allamakee County or Fayette County is the Turner Hall Community Center at 119 E Greene Street, in Postville. 

Clayton County residents’ voting place is also Turner Hall in Postville. Qualified voters in Clayton County are voters who reside in one of the following townships: Grand Meadow, Marion, Monona, Wagner, and Postville. 

Winneshiek County residents’ voting place is Ossian Community Center, located at 123 W Main Street, Ossian. 

Polling places at both locations will open at 7 a.m. and close at 8 p.m. 

As a reminder, items on the ballot will be as follows:

To elect a person to fill the vacancy on the Postville Community School District’s board of directors;

A Revenue Purpose Statement that will specify the use of revenue the Postville Community School District receives from the State of Iowa Secure and Advance Vision for Education Fund.

Postville School District Superintendent Brendan Knudtson would like to remind the public that the Revenue Purpose Statement is not a vote to increase tax revenue, but rather a vote for how revenue is going to be used.
